Amarillo man who refused to serve prison sentence extradited from New Jersey

AMARILLO, Texas (KFDA) – A man who went to extraordinary lengths to fight his conviction has been brought from New Jersey to Potter County to serve his sentence.

In 2020, Edward David James was charged with assault on a family member by impeding breath or circulation.

The report from Amarillo Police Department shows the victim told police that her boyfriend punched her several times in the face, causing her glasses to break…
